Securing Your Venture with the FCA

Embarking on a new venture as a organization in the UK? Navigating the FCA licensing procedure can seem daunting, but it doesn't have to be overwhelming stress. With thorough planning and understanding of the requirements, you can smoothly complete this essential step.

First, ensure you understand the particular get more info FCA guidelines that pertain your industry. Different types of firms have unique obligations.

Once you've determined these, gather the required documentation. This typically includes your business plan, proof of identity, and financial records.

Submit your application digitally through the FCA's platform. Be meticulous in providing all facts to avoid delays or rejections. The review system can require several months, so be patient.

Preserve open communication with the FCA throughout this stage and promptly handle any questions.

Essential Steps for Successful FCA Company Registration

Securing your registration with the Financial Conduct Authority (FCA) is a crucial step for any company operating in the financial services sector. To navigate this process successfully, you need to follow these essential steps:

First, conduct thorough research to understand the specific regulatory requirements applicable to your business model. This includes determining the appropriate regulatory framework for your activities and ensuring compliance with all relevant legislation.

Next, you will need to compile a comprehensive application package that includes detailed information about your company's structure, operations, financial position, and core personnel. Be sure to lodge your application through the FCA's online portal and adhere to all filing guidelines.

Throughout the application process, maintain open communication with the FCA and be prepared to provide any further information or documentation they may require. Finally, confirm your company has established robust compliance procedures to prevent financial crime and protect customer funds.

By following these essential steps, you can increase your chances of a successful FCA company registration and operate within the regulatory framework with confidence.
